· ·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 809 6.5.4 Filter
D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 812 7 Integrate 814 com/tidb/v8.1/system-variables#tidb_
dml_ �→ type-new-in-v800">Bulk
DML for much larger transactions ( �→ experimental, introduced in v8.0.0)
Large batch DML jobs, such as extensive cleanup jobs �→ previously been limited at very large scales. Bulk DML (tidb_ �→ dml_type = "bulk" ) is a new DML type for handling large batch �→ DML tasks more efficiently while providing transaction guarantees 0 码力 |
6479 页 |
108.61 MB
| 9 月前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 814 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 817 7 Integrate 819 PROCESSLIST system tables add the SESSION_ALIAS field to show the number of rows currently affected by the DML statement #46889 @lcwangchao 2.2.3 Deprecated features • The following features are deprecated starting threads using tidb_gc_ �→ concurrency #54570 @ekexium • Improve the performance of bulk DML execution mode (tidb_dml_type = "bulk �→ ") #50215 @ekexium • Improve the performance of schema information cache-related 0 码力 |
6606 页 |
109.48 MB
| 9 月前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 898 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 901 7 Stream Data 903 · · · · · · · · · · · · · · · · · · · · · · · · · · · 1211 7.7.28 What is the order of executing DML and DDL statements? · · · · · · · · · · 1211 7.7.29 How should I check whether the upstream and downstream ·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 6723 17.4.3 Data Modification Language (DML)· ·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 6723 17.4.4 Development Milestone Release 0 码力 |
6730 页 |
111.36 MB
| 9 月前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 889 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 892 7 Integrate 894 transactions and TiDB CPU usage #55287 @you06 • Optimize the execution performance of DML statements when the system variable tidb_dml_type is set to "bulk" #50215 @ekexium • Support using Optimizer Fix Control Merge in scenarios with empty tables and small Regions #17376 @LykxSassinator • Prevent Pipelined DML from blocking resolved-ts for long periods #17459 @ekexium • PD • Support graceful offline of TiKV 0 码力 |
6705 页 |
110.86 MB
| 9 月前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 811 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 814 7 Integrate 816 Y Automatically terminating long-running idle transactions Y Y N N N N N N N N Bulk DML execution mode (tidb_dml_type = "bulk") E E N N N N N N N N 2.3.7 Partitioning Partitioning 8.2 8.1 7.5 7.1 6 run SQL statements in it. This page walks you through the basic TiDB SQL statements such as DDL, DML and CRUD operations. For a complete list of TiDB statements, see SQL Statement Overview. 3.3.1 Category 0 码力 |
6549 页 |
108.77 MB
| 9 月前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 720 6.4.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 723 7 Integrate 725 becomes GA • Support user-level lock management, compatible with MySQL • Support non-transactional DML statements (only support DELETE) • TiFlash supports on-demand data compaction • MPP introduces the storage, thus improving the cluster stability. User document, #10578 • Support non-transactional DML statement In the scenarios of large data processing, a single SQL statement with a large trans- action 0 码力 |
4487 页 |
84.44 MB
| 1 年前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 826 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 829 7 Integrate 831 pingcap.com/tidb/v8.0/system-variables#tidb_dml_ �→ type-new-in-v800">Bulk DML for much larger transactions (experimental �→ ) | Large batch DML jobs, such as extensive cleanup jobs, joins �→ previously been limited at very large scales. Bulk DML (tidb_ �→ dml_type = "bulk" ) is a new DML type for handling large batch �→ DML tasks more efficiently while providing transaction guarantees 0 码力 |
6327 页 |
107.55 MB
| 1 年前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 798 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 801 7 Integrate 803 com/tidb/v8.1/system-variables#tidb_dml_ �→ type-new-in-v800">Bulk DML for much larger transactions ( �→ experimental, introduced in v8.0.0) | Large batch DML jobs, such as extensive cleanup jobs �→ previously been limited at very large scales. Bulk DML (tidb_ �→ dml_type = "bulk" ) is a new DML type for handling large batch �→ DML tasks more efficiently while providing transaction guarantees 0 码力 |
6321 页 |
107.46 MB
| 1 年前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 792 6.4.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 795 7 7 Integrate 797 improve the DML success rate during DDL change (GA) #37275 @wjhuang2016 TiDB v6.3.0 introduces Metadata lock as an experimental feature. To avoid the Information schema is changed error caused by DML statements feature is now compatible with TiCDC and PITR and becomes GA. This feature helps you to easily undo DML misoperations, restore the original cluster in minutes, and roll back data at different time points 0 码力 |
5282 页 |
99.69 MB
| 1 年前 3 ·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· · 808 6.5.4 Filter DML Events Using SQL Expressions · · · · · · · · · · · · · · · · · · · · · · · · 811 7 Integrate 813 also supports committing every fixed number of rows by setting the tidb_dml_batch_size system variable. Starting from v7.0.0, tidb_dml_batch_size no longer takes effect on LOAD DATA and TiDB commits all rows transaction. Starting from v7.6.0, TiDB processes LOAD DATA in transactions in the same way as other DML statements, especially in the same way as MySQL. The LOAD DATA state- ment in a transaction no longer 0 码力 |
6123 页 |
107.24 MB
| 1 年前 3
|